Yarmolenko Scored the 124th Goal in the UPL and Repeated the Record of Shatsky
Yarmolenko scored the 124th goal in the UPL and repeated Shatsky's record Andriy Yarmolenko scored the 124th goal in the UPL and equaled Maksym Shatsky. The next ball will make him the sole record holder.
